> The Design Team has produced two documents:
> - A requirement document: draft-srcompdt-spring-compression-requirement
> - A solution analysis document: draft-srcompdt-spring-compression-analysis
>  
> Both have been presented to the WG and triggered some discussions but are still individual documents.
> We believe it's now time for the WG to consider taking ownership of those two documents.
> Note that, especially for those two documents, WG adoption does not necessarily mean RFC publication in particular if it turns out that the benefit of long term archive would not justify the WG and IESG effort to finalize those two documents.
